A demó SecurityTest applet/application osztály megmutatja az applet/applikáció közötti külömséget

Íme a source és a lefordított bytekód

A teszt akkor nyújt összehasonlítható eredményeket, ha letöltésre kerünek a következõ fájlok:

Ekkor ugyanis ki lehet próbálni, hogy mik a külömbségek akkor, ha az osztály mint applet (appletviewer vagy netscape SecurityTest.html) vagy mint application (java SecurityTest) kerül végrehajtásra. Sõt azt is ki lehet próbálni, mi történik, ha a SecurityTest.class könyvtárat bevesszük a CLASSPATH környezeti változóba.

Az interfész használata:
resume: az applet ThreadGroup-ja resume() metódusának meghívása
properties: System.getProperties() eredményének kiiratása
prorocol: getAudioClip(getCodeBase(), "../clip.au") végrehajtása
read: /tmp/SecurityTest.test fájl olvasása
write: /tmp/SecurityTest.test fájl írása
delete: /tmp/SecurityTest.test fájl törlése
exec: /tmp/SecurityTest.test fájl törlése a /usr/bin/rm meghívásával
socket: ludens.elte.hu 7-es(echo) socketjével kommunikálás
clear: szövegkijelzõ törlése
exit: System.exit(0) meghívása

Ez a browser program nem képes appletek megjelenítésére!